Reuse Egg Cartons for Paper Beads

Posted on Apr 5, 2009 in How-To's / Tutorials | 2 comments

An egg carton is one of those perfect containers for small things like beads (specially seed beads), paper clips etc.  Just to make it more fun and to give color to a desk or work space you can paint it with leftover craft paint.  I made one, and put a handle to it to hold my paper beads which are really small.  It is the perfect container when you want to separate colors and size.  The handle is fashioned from a leftover craft wire, you just punch a hole or just stick it into the carton and wrap it around one or two times, and so with the other side, it make it easy to carry around.
